About this day nursery

Patchway Centre Pre-School & Tots, established in 1996, operates as a childcare setting on non-domestic premises in Bristol, caring for children aged 2-4 years. The pre-school received a 'Good' rating in its latest Ofsted inspection on 6th February 2026.

Children are welcomed into a nurturing environment where they confidently self-register and eagerly engage with friends and activities, demonstrating independence and a love for learning. The setting prioritises strong relationships with families, actively supporting regular attendance and offering a curriculum based on the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S).

Patchway Centre Pre-School & Tots places a strong emphasis on emotional well-being, with staff caring for children with warmth and consistency. Clear routines help children understand expectations, promoting good hygiene and healthy eating habits.

The pre-school encourages extensive outdoor play, allowing children to move freely between indoor and outdoor areas, exploring mud, water, and engaging in imaginative activities. Children with special educational needs and/or disabilities (SEND) make impressive progress in communication, benefiting from staff who adapt the curriculum to ensure all children can access and succeed in their learning journey.

Inspector highlights

  • All children make progress across all areas of learning, using a broad vocabulary and speaking confidently.
  • Children with special educational needs and/or disabilities make impressive progress with their communication.
  • Leaders and staff build strong relationships with families and work closely to support children's regular attendance.
  • Children show a love of learning, with good concentration and eagerness to take part.
  • Staff care for children with warmth and consistency, placing a strong emphasis on emotional wellbeing.
  • Clear routines help children understand expectations and promote good hygiene and healthy eating.

Areas to develop

  • 1Leaders should implement clear, individual professional development targets so that staff receive precise guidance and support to strengthen their knowledge and further improve the quality of teaching.
  • 2Leaders should continue to strengthen the quality of teaching to facilitate more opportunities for children to experiment, test ideas and extend their learning.

Inclusion & environment

How they support every child

SEND provision

Children with special educational needs and/or disabilities (SEND) make impressive progress with their communication, using signs and following instructions with increasing independence. Staff adapt the curriculum so all children, particularly those with special educational needs and/or disabilities, can access and succeed in their learning. All children, including disadvantaged children and children with SEND, form secure attachments with staff and make progress from their individual starting points with dedicated staff using meaningful step-by-step targets.

Outdoor space

Children spend plenty of time outdoors, exploring mud and water and engaging in imaginative play. They can freely move between indoor and outdoor areas, choosing from a variety of activities. Staff complete thorough risk assessments and supervise children effectively.
